Original Description
Eugen von Guerard’s Shipwreck at the Australian Coast (1864) is a dramatic masterpiece of 19th-century Australian landscape painting, blending Romanticism’s emotional intensity with meticulous realism. The painting captures a storm-lashed shoreline, where a crippled ship succumbs to violent waves beneath brooding, windswept skies. Von Guerard’s precision in detailing the ship’s splintered masts and the frothy surge of the ocean immerses viewers in nature’s sublime power—a hallmark of his Germanic training and the Hudson River School’s influence. As a key figure in Australia’s colonial art scene, von Guerard documented the continent’s untamed beauty while elevating its landscapes to high art. This work remains historically significant for its fusion of European Romantic traditions with Australian topography, cementing his legacy as a bridge between Old World techniques and New World subjects.
